  • Notes
  • Three dials (primary tuning control knobs). Error in Radio Collector's Guide 1921-1932: The "Consomello Grand" as a console has not an untuned RF amplifier, but 2 tuned RF stages and the Detector - plus 3 Audio stages - the same as the table model from a year before. We show the advertisement of the table model also here because we could not find yet a picture of the console - which might be the same on the top. In any case for the table model there is already a compartment for both "A" and "B" batteries as well as built in loud speaker. In the Radio Collector's Guide we find for some models the name Consomello and for others Consonello (n instead of m). This is probably correct since the distinction is not only once made - only ads will hopefully tell (in the future).
